ORA-19228: XP0008 - undeclared identifier: prefix 'string' local-name 'string'

Cause : The givne identiifer refesr to eitehr a typ ename, fnuction nmae, namepsace preifx, or vraiable nmae that si not deifned in hte stati ccontext.

Action - How to fix it : DBA Scripts :: www.high-oracle.com/scripts

Fix thee xpressino to remvoe the iedntifier ,or declrae the appropriat evariabl,e type, ufnction ro namespcae.

update : 27-04-2017
ORA-19228

ORA-19228 - XP0008 - undeclared identifier: prefix 'string' local-name 'string'
ORA-19228 - XP0008 - undeclared identifier: prefix 'string' local-name 'string'

  • ora-13360 : invalid subtype in a compound type
  • ora-26527 : local store callback init phase failed for 'string.string'
  • ora-12717 : Cannot issue ALTER DATABASE NATIONAL CHARACTER SET when NCLOB, NCHAR or NVARCHAR2 data exists
  • ora-14636 : only 2 resulting subpartition can be specified for SPLIT SUBPARTITION
  • ora-14155 : missing PARTITION or SUBPARTITION keyword
  • ora-16511 : messaging error using ksrget
  • ora-06912 : CMX: write error in datarq
  • ora-02487 : Error in converting trace data
  • ora-00088 : command cannot be executed by shared server
  • ora-30031 : the suspended (resumable) statement has been aborted
  • ora-08468 : mask option string is not supported
  • ora-12504 : TNS:listener was not given the SID in CONNECT_DATA
  • ora-14023 : creation of GLOBAL partitioned cluster indices is not supported
  • ora-33076 : (XSAGDNGL37) In AGGMAP workspace object, the value 'number' is not a valid value of dimension workspace object.
  • ora-06301 : IPA: Cannot allocate driver context
  • ora-02357 : no valid dump files
  • ora-13859 : Action cannot be specified without the module specification
  • ora-19568 : a device is already allocated to this session
  • ora-10641 : Cannot find a rollback segment to bind to
  • ora-02880 : smpini: Could not register PGA for protection
  • ora-13447 : GeoRaster metadata BRS error
  • ora-23457 : invalid flavor ID string
  • ora-22895 : referenced table "string" in schema "string" is not an object table
  • ora-01351 : tablespace given for Logminer dictionary does not exist
  • ora-00965 : column aliases not allowed for '*'
  • ora-01491 : CASCADE option not valid
  • ora-16239 : IMMEDIATE option not available without standby redo logs
  • ora-01841 : (full) year must be between -4713 and +9999, and not be 0
  • ora-32631 : illegal use of objects in MODEL
  • ora-39960 : scope can only be SYSTEM or SESSION
  • Oracle Database Error Messages



    Oracle Database High Availability Any organization evaluating a database solution for enterprise data must also evaluate the High Availability (HA) capabilities of the database. Data is one of the most critical business assets of an organization. If this data is not available and/or not protected, companies may stand to lose millions of dollars in business downtime as well as negative publicity. Building a highly available data infrastructure is critical to the success of all organizations in today's fast moving economy.

    Well, the reason for above error is that i have taken the above script from a 11g database and running it on 10g database. 11g has bring some changes in password management. Below code is executed on 11g and user created successfully, which is expected result.